THE WCI-CHINA ROUTE WAS TRADED IN THE MID US$ 10,000S - BRS DRY BULK
As reported by BRS Dry Bulk, after a stronger than expected performance in 2010, rates finished on a sombre note in December with the BDI at1,773 points. Apart from the slump seen in July, this is the lowest level recorded for 2010. Early predictions that Chinese ore imports would continue to drive the market up in 2010 proved incorrect. Official figures show China imported 560.5m tones Jan-Nov, compared to565.8m in the same period in 2009.Among exporters, Australia was the biggest beneficiary, increasing its exports to China by 2.4% year-on-year, while the other major producers Brazil, India and South Africa saw their exports decline approximately 9%, 7% and 12%. However China continues to diversify its ore sources, and many smaller producers such as Iran, Indonesia, Peru and Chile increased their sales during 2010.
Supramax/Handy
The market has been very quiet over the last ten days, and verging on non-existent. Christmas brought no relief to the ships open in the east, with rates still holding in the region of US$ 10-11,000 per day for local employment. The pace of new building deliveries of Supramax and Handies is fast and charterers can afford to be choosy. India failed to maintain the momentum seen before Christmas and the west coast India/ China run was being fixed at US$ 15,000, as opposed to the US$ 18,000 and over which was seen at that time. Over the holidays one could see ballasters leaving east coast India in a southbound direction. By comparison the Atlantic is faring a little bit better with hardly any prompt positions of Supramax in the south Atlantic or USG. Handies seem more affected with plenty of spot/prompt positions all over the place. Transatlantic round voyages are getting fixed at around US$ 15-16,000 for Supras and US$10-12,000 for modern Handies. The demand for long period has disappeared, which may be a sign of operators’ hesitation to commit in an uncertain future.
Panamax
This week was very quiet as expected during the festive season. The TA round market hovered in the mid US$ 20,000s per day and seemed stable, mainly due to the thin number of candidates open in this area and some ECSA cargoes activity. However, ballasters from the Far East and India were apparent and should balance out the market. Out of India, the market was relatively quiet. Goa’s exports were impacted by the truckers’ strike and the iron ore ban continues. The WCI-China route was traded in the mid US$ 10,000s. The ECI market was relatively quiet except for Haldia. In the Far East, the market did not improve and levels reached US$ 8-8,500 per day for a Nopac round. The short period activity was sluggish and the last reported fixtures were hanging around the mid US$ 10,000s for Tess 74 delivery North China or India redelivery worldwide. One-year period candidates were traded around US$ 16-17,000 per day.
Capsize
A very quiet week for the Cape market, with little happening in the last ten days of the year. Overall the sentiment appeared flat to weakening, and in the futures market short-term prices fell. January Cape 4TC is now trading at just over US$ 20,000 per day, compared to overUS$ 23,000 in the week before Christmas. However for 2H 2011 rates remain little changed. Ship deliveries slowed in the final fortnight of the year, but we can expect a ‘bunching’ of deliveries in early 2011 as ships completed in December are held over for the new year.
